






SHANGHAI, Jun. 12 (SMM) – LME nickel prices opened at USD 18,700/mt overnight, with the high end of the price range USD 18,790/mt, and finding support at USD 18,229/mt. Finally, LME nickel prices closed at USD 18,250/mt, down USD 450/mt from the previous trading day. Trading volumes increased by 1,647 lots, to 5,564 lots and total positions increased by 1,157 lots to 230,572 lots. LME nickel inventories were up 126 mt to 286,752 mt.
Negative effects from China's probe into financing fraud at the Port of Qingdao continued to affect copper and nickel prices.
LME nickel prices are expected to move between USD 18,000-18,500/mt today, and spot nickel prices in Shanghai will move between RMB 126,500-129,000/mt.
